We invite students across all UMB schools, as well as staff and faculty, to a weekly, one-hour Writing & AI Q&A session beginning in February. These informal, drop-in conversations provide space to ask questions about using generative AI for writing — such as papers, discussion posts, reports, articles, and theses — while also exploring academic integrity, ethical considerations, and when AI may or may not support learning.

UMB Writing Center leadership and consultants will facilitate these sessions and provide guidance to attendees about questions and concerns relating to writing and AI. Come share concerns, learn from others, and think critically together about writing in an age of AI.

You can also submit a question about writing & AI before a session via the UMB Writing Center’s website. Answers to these questions, as well as summaries of issues discussed in each session, will be posted on the UMB Writing Center website, in addition to the resources listed in the Center’s Writing & AI resource guide.

Register for these weekly sessions via Zoom and join us on Thursdays at 2 pm US EST, from February 5 to May 7, 2026.
